一种验证方法、装置、电子设备及可读存储介质制造方法及图纸

技术编号:44411331 阅读:22 留言:0更新日期:2025-02-25 10:25
本发明专利技术实施例提供一种验证方法、装置、电子设备及可读存储介质,该方法包括:在第一文件中配置测试项,并在测试程序的链接脚本中设置所述第一文件的链接地址;所述测试程序用于为所述测试项的测试用例提供底层运行环境;基于编译工具链和所述链接脚本对所述测试程序进行编译处理,得到所述测试程序对应的二进制文件;对所述二进制文件和所述第一文件进行镜像打包,得到第一镜像文件;在仿真系统中加载所述第一镜像文件,并驱动待测设计运行所述测试程序,以从所述链接地址中加载所述第一文件,执行所述测试项对应的测试用例。本发明专利技术实施例可以降低测试程序的编译功耗,有利于提升处理器芯片系统整体的验证效率。

【技术实现步骤摘要】

本专利技术涉及计算机,尤其涉及一种验证方法、装置、电子设备及可读存储介质


技术介绍

1、在中央处理器(central processing unit,cpu)芯片系统验证中,由于测试项很多,通常需要编译很多测试项用来测试。当测试程序的通用代码发生变化(进行了优化或者修复了bug)时,所有的测试项都需要重新编译更新,使用修改后的测试程序进行测试。而测试项有时多达成百上千,这样的重新编译过程耗时耗力。


技术实现思路

1、本专利技术实施例提供一种验证方法、装置、电子设备及可读存储介质,可以解决相关技术中测试程序的通用代码发生变化后,重新编译过程耗时耗力的问题。

2、一方面,本专利技术实施例公开了一种验证方法,所述方法包括:

3、在第一文件中配置测试项,并在测试程序的链接脚本中设置所述第一文件的链接地址;所述测试程序用于为所述测试项的测试用例提供底层运行环境;

4、基于编译工具链和所述链接脚本对所述测试程序进行编译处理,得到所述测试程序对应的二进制文件;>

5、对所述二本文档来自技高网...

【技术保护点】

1.一种验证方法,其特征在于,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述方法还包括:

3.根据权利要求1所述的方法,其特征在于,所述方法还包括:

4.根据权利要求1所述的方法,其特征在于,所述对所述二进制文件和所述第一文件进行镜像打包,得到第一镜像文件,包括:

5.根据权利要求1所述的方法,其特征在于,所述在第一文件中配置测试项之前,所述方法还包括:

6.根据权利要求1所述的方法,其特征在于,所述编译工具链包括编译器和链接器;所述基于编译工具链和所述链接脚本对所述测试程序进行编译处理,得到所述测试程序对应的二...

【技术特征摘要】

1.一种验证方法,其特征在于,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述方法还包括:

3.根据权利要求1所述的方法,其特征在于,所述方法还包括:

4.根据权利要求1所述的方法,其特征在于,所述对所述二进制文件和所述第一文件进行镜像打包,得到第一镜像文件,包括:

5.根据权利要求1所述的方法,其特征在于,所述在第一文件中配置测试项之前,所述方法还包括:

6.根据权利要求1所述的方法,其特征在于,所述编译工具链包括编译器和链接器;所述基于编译工具链和所述链接脚本对所述测试程序进行编译处理,得到所述测试程序...

【专利技术属性】
技术研发人员:郭亚星王然宋炳豪李贤飞王洋张健宁宇包云岗唐丹
申请(专利权)人:北京开源芯片研究院
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1